Create a start-of-shift inspection
Check visible leakage, abnormal sound, pump seal condition, lubrication, instrument readings and housekeeping before production. Small changes are easier to correct before they become shutdowns.
Track operating baselines
Record motor current, circulation flow, temperature, batch time and solution concentration. Trends reveal fouling, wear or process changes earlier than a single alarm.
Plan cleaning around the chemistry
Deposits and crystals can restrict piping, instruments and heat-transfer surfaces. Cleaning methods must be compatible with the materials of construction and the plant’s chemical-safety procedures.
Keep critical spares locally
Maintain a site list of seals, bearings, gaskets, sensors, contactors and consumables. The final list should reflect actual operating experience, local availability and overseas delivery time.
